Welcome to Kochi, the starting point of your Kerala adventure! In the morning, explore Fort Kochi, known for its colonial architecture and Chinese fishing nets. Afternoon, visit the Mattancherry Palace, showcasing the rich history of the region. In the evening, enjoy a Kathakali dance performance, a traditional form of Indian classical dance.
Embark on a scenic drive to Munnar, famous for its lush tea gardens. Morning, visit the Tata Tea Museum to learn about tea processing and history. Afternoon, explore the beautiful Eravikulam National Park, home to endangered Nilgiri Tahr. In the evening, take a leisurely stroll through the tea plantations and enjoy the serene surroundings.
Experience the enchanting backwaters of Kerala in Alleppey. Morning, embark on a houseboat cruise along the scenic canals, enjoying the peaceful ambiance. Afternoon, indulge in a traditional Kerala lunch served on the houseboat. In the evening, witness a mesmerizing sunset over the backwaters.
Embark on a day trip to witness the breathtaking Athirapally Falls. Morning, explore the cascading waterfalls and enjoy the picturesque surroundings. Afternoon, visit Thrissur, known as the cultural capital of Kerala, and explore the Vadakkunnathan Temple and Thrissur Zoo. In the evening, attend a traditional Kerala Kathakali performance.
Head to Thekkady, home to the renowned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ary. Morning, embark on a boat safari on Periyar Lake, where you might spot elephants, tigers, and various bird species. Afternoon, take a guided nature walk in the sanctuary. In the evening, explore the vibrant spice markets in Thekkady.
Travel to Kovalam, a popular beach destination in Kerala. Morning, unwind on the golden sands of Kovalam Beach and take a dip in the Arabian Sea. Afternoon, visit the iconic Lighthouse Beach and explore the local shops for souvenirs. In the evening, indulge in a rejuvenating Ayurvedic massage.
Conclude your Kerala trip in Varkala, known for its stunning cliffs and peaceful beach. Morning, visit the Varkala Cliff, offering breathtaking views of the Arabian Sea. Afternoon, relax on the pristine Varkala Beach and soak up the sun. In the evening, witness a mesmerizing sunset from the cliff while enjoying delicious local seafood.
For a family-friendly off-the-beaten-path experience, visit the Thattekad Bird Sanctuary. It's a haven for bird lovers, with over 300 species of colorful birds. Another local favorite is the Marari Beach, a serene and less crowded beach near Alleppey, perfect for relaxing and enjoying the natural beauty of Kerala.
